Course structure

• The Role of a Teen Book Club Facilitator
• Understanding Teen Literature Trends
• Creating Engaging Book Club Discussion Questions
• Incorporating Technology in Teen Book Clubs
• Promoting Diversity and Inclusion in Book Selection
• Dealing with Challenging Situations in Teen Book Clubs
• Evaluating the Success of Teen Book Club Events
• Marketing and Promoting Teen Book Club Events
• Collaborating with Schools and Libraries
• Building a Teen Book Club Community
